chorten

[ˈtʃɔːtən]

chorten Definition

a Buddhist shrine or stupa, typically with a pyramidal or conical roof and containing sacred relics.

Summary: chorten in Brief

A 'chorten' [ˈtʃɔːtən] is a Buddhist shrine or stupa that contains sacred relics. It is often characterized by a pyramidal or conical roof and is a symbol of enlightenment and peace. 'Chorten' is sometimes used interchangeably with 'stupa,' and it is often accompanied by other structures like mani walls and prayer flags.
